Apothecary bottle with stopper
Object name
Apothecary bottle with stopper
Date
1880-1920
Medium
Glass
Dimensions
Overall: 10 3/4 x 4 1/2 in. ( 27.3 x 11.4 cm )
Description
Clear blown glass apothecary bottle with straight cylindrical sides, label on back, short cylindrical neck with flanged lip, sloping curved shoulders, pontil mark.
Object Number
Z.1102
Marks
handwritten: on back, in ink: "ER #/(illeg.)"
printed: on reverse (visible through glass): "F. S. Stevens & Co.,/Licensed/Pharmacists,/Bridgeport,/Conn."
